Prattville, Chelsea, MA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Prattville?
| Bedroom | Average Price | Cheapest Price | Highest Price |
|---|---|---|---|
| Prattville Studio Apartments | $2,420 | $1,200 | $3,015 |
| Prattville 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,703 | $1,000 | $5,199 |
| Prattville 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,351 | $1,850 | $5,780 |
| Prattville 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,755 | $1,000 | $6,250 |
| Prattville 4 Bedroom Apartments | $4,204 | $2,400 | $10,000+ |
| Prattville 5 Bedroom Apartments | $4,545 | $3,800 | $7,000 |
